The revisions proposed in the December 31, 2008 Information Collection Request for OMB Control Number 3206-0005 are not approved. Per the letter from OPM Acting Director Kathie Anne Whipple to OMB Director Peter Orszag, dated 2/18/09, OMB is approving for a period of one year the 3206-0005 collection in the version previously approved, in order to provide the current AdministrationÂs officials at OPM and other concerned agencies the opportunity to review the collection and propose revisions as necessary based on their review. The previous terms of clearance remain in effect. Six months before the expiration of this approval, OPM must provide OMB a status report of the review.
